Roasted Brussels Sprouts with Red Pepper and Garlic

Prep Time: 15 mins
Cook Time: 25 mins
Total Time: 40 mins
Cuisine: American
Serves: 4 servings

Ingredients

  1. 1 pound Brussels sprouts, trimmed and halved
  2. 1 red bell pepper, diced
  3. 3 cloves garlic, minced
  4. 3 tablespoons olive oil
  5.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 425°F (218°C), ensuring the rack is positioned in the center of the oven for even roasting.
  2. Prepare the Brussels sprouts by washing them thoroughly under cool running water, then pat dry with clean paper towels to remove excess moisture.
  3. Trim the stem ends of the Brussels sprouts and slice each sprout in half lengthwise, creating a flat surface that will caramelize beautifully during roasting.
  4. Dice the red bell pepper into uniform 1/2-inch pieces to ensure consistent cooking and even distribution of color and flavor.
  5. Mince the garlic cloves finely, releasing their aromatic oils and ensuring they will infuse the vegetables with rich, savory flavor.
  6. In a large mixing bowl, combine the halved Brussels sprouts, diced red pepper, and minced garlic.
  7. Drizzle the olive oil over the vegetables, then season generously with salt and freshly ground black pepper.
  8. Toss the ingredients thoroughly, ensuring every piece is evenly coated with oil and seasonings.
  9. Spread the vegetable mixture in a single layer on a large rimmed baking sheet, making sure the pieces are not overcrowded to promote proper roasting and caramelization.
  10. Place the baking sheet in the preheated oven and roast for 20-25 minutes, stirring once halfway through cooking to ensure even browning.
  11. The Brussels sprouts are done when they are golden brown, crispy on the edges, and tender when pierced with a fork.
  12. Remove from the oven and let rest for 2-3 minutes to allow flavors to settle and vegetables to cool slightly.
  13. Transfer to a serving dish and enjoy immediately while hot and crispy.

Tips

  1. Pat those Brussels sprouts completely dry before roasting – moisture is the enemy of crispy caramelization!
  2. Use a large, rimmed baking sheet and don't overcrowd the vegetables. Give them space to breathe, or they'll steam instead of roast.
  3. Cut your Brussels sprouts in half to maximize those deliciously crispy, golden-brown edges.
  4. High heat is key – 425°F creates that perfect exterior crunch while keeping the inside tender.
  5. Invest in a good quality olive oil and don't be shy with seasoning. Salt and pepper are your flavor friends here.
  6. Stir the vegetables once halfway through cooking to ensure even browning and prevent burning.
